Course

Objectives

(a) search, select, adapt and tailor-make e- reading resources for English Language;

(b) understand the use of e-library and multimedia information system of LCSD, e-book platform of HKEdCity and other reading resources on the Internet;

(12)

Course

objectives, contd.

(d) understand the learning

opportunities, features, strength and limitations of e-reading resources and IT tools for reading activities;

(e) understand the essential elements in the design of e-reading activities (including reading activity in and out of lessons e.g.

reading scheme, cross-curricular projects and RaC, etc.) in consideration of the pedagogy and connection with the curriculum of English Language from the case study of exemplars for primary and secondary school students;

(13)

Course

objectives, contd.

(f) create and modify simple design of reading activities by using various e- reading resources, IT tools and

innovative pedagogies;

(g) monitor and evaluate the reading progress of students and provide quality feedback to enhance learning and teaching effectiveness by using appropriate IT tools; and

Assignment

Throughout the 2 sessions, you will be invited to browse certain e-Reading resources,

applications, ideas, and try out some e-Reading activities.

On the Worksheet given, respond to the tasks assigned, take notes on the resources and ideas that are of particular interest to you and which you would want to follow up on after this course.

Submit your completed worksheet to the course instructors at the end of each session, while

keeping one copy for yourself.
